[发明专利]浏览器下载任务管理方法、装置及用户终端在审
申请号: | 201611187637.1 | 申请日: | 2016-12-20 |
公开(公告)号: | CN108206854A | 公开(公告)日: | 2018-06-26 |
发明(设计)人: | 宋鑫;沈艨;张玉娟 | 申请(专利权)人: | 广州市动景计算机科技有限公司 |
主分类号: | H04L29/08 | 分类号: | H04L29/08 |
代理公司: | 北京超凡志成知识产权代理事务所(普通合伙) 11371 | 代理人: | 唐维虎 |
地址: | 510000 广东省广州市天河区*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 下载 用户终端 浏览器 任务处理请求 下载任务管理 下载请求 计算机领域 任务等待 | ||
本发明提供了一种浏览器下载任务管理方法、装置及用户终端,涉及计算机领域。其中,所述方法包括:接收下载任务处理请求;当所述下载任务处理请求为下载请求,判断正在下载的下载任务数量是否达到最大下载数,所述最大下载数为允许同时进行下载的下载任务的最大数量;当正在下载的下载任务数量达到所述最大下载数,使所述下载请求对应的下载任务等待下载。该方法、装置及用户终端可以使浏览器进行下载任务的下载时,部分下载任务可以优先下载,提高了优先下载的下载任务的下载速度,使优先下载的下载任务的下载时间更短。
技术领域
本发明涉及计算机技术领域,具体而言,涉及一种浏览器下载任务管理方法、装置及用户终端。
背景技术
用户可以利用浏览器对需要下载的文件进行下载。现有技术中,当浏览器下载多个下载任务时,对该多个下载任务的下载同时进行。并且,当有新的下载请求(如由暂停转换为下载的下载请求)时,新的下载请求对应的下载任务直接开始下载,抢占正在下载的下载任务的带宽,从而导致单项下载任务的下载速度降低,每个单项下载任务完成下载都需要较长的下载时间。
发明内容
有鉴于此,本发明实施例提供了一种浏览器下载任务管理方法、装置及用户终端,根据下载任务数量与最大下载数的关系响应下载请求,使浏览器的所有下载任务中的部分下载任务可以优先下载,以解决上述问题。
为了实现上述目的,本发明采用的技术方案如下:
一种浏览器下载任务管理方法,所述方法包括:接收下载任务处理请求;当所述下载任务处理请求为下载请求,判断正在下载的下载任务数量是否达到最大下载数,所述最大下载数为允许同时进行下载的下载任务的最大数量;当正在下载的下载任务数量达到所述最大下载数,使所述下载请求对应的下载任务等待下载。
一种浏览器下载任务管理装置,所述装置包括:请求接收模块,用于接收下载任务处理请求;下载响应模块,当所述下载任务处理请求为下载请求,用于判断正在下载的下载任务数量是否达到最大下载数,所述最大下载数为允许同时进行下载的下载任务的最大数量;第一等待模块,当正在下载的下载任务数量达到所述最大下载数,用于使所述下载请求对应的下载任务等待下载。
一种用户终端,所述用户终端包括存储器和处理器,所述存储器耦接到所述处理器,所述存储器存储指令,当所述指令由所述处理器执行时使所述处理器执行以下操作:接收下载任务处理请求;当所述下载任务处理请求为下载请求,判断正在下载的下载任务数量是否达到最大下载数,所述最大下载数为允许同时进行下载的下载任务的最大数量;当正在下载的下载任务数量达到所述最大下载数,使所述下载请求对应的下载任务等待下载。
本发明实施例提供的浏览器下载任务管理方法、装置及用户终端,当接收到下载请求时,判断正在下载的下载任务数量是否达到最大下载数,若达到,则将该下载请求对应的下载任务等待下载,以使部分下载任务可以优先下载,相比于现有技术的所有下载请求同时下载,提高了优先下载的下载请求的下载速度。
为使本发明的上述目的、特征和优点能更明显易懂,下文特举较佳实施例,并配合所附附图,作详细说明如下。
附图说明
为使本发明实施例的目的、技术方案和优点更加清楚,下面将结合本发明实施例中的附图,对本发明实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例是本发明一部分实施例,而不是全部的实施例。基于本发明中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都属于本发明保护的范围。
图1示出了本发明较佳实施例提供的用户终端的方框示意图;
图2示出了本发明第一实施例提供的浏览器下载任务管理方法的流程图;
图3示出了本发明第一实施例提供的浏览器下载任务管理方法的另一种部分步骤的流程图;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于广州市动景计算机科技有限公司,未经广州市动景计算机科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201611187637.1/2.html,转载请声明来源钻瓜专利网。
- 上一篇:车辆间通信的方法和装置
- 下一篇:一种基于物联网的集约化畜禽养殖管理系统